I have a US slingbox which i am setting up on a SKY digibox in the UK.
I have attached all the cables, have it connected to router.
I have downloaded and have got the sky codes working.
a few problems
1 - The feed is in black and white, with no audio
2 - can't get sky channel changing to work even after downloading rm files.
3 - cn't set up router. I have a wireless BT Voyager modem/router, and BT broadband.

Any Help or ideas greatly appreciated

stevie.. the standard in uk is pal
sky is in pal..
the regular US slingbox only processes ntsc signal..
so unless your tv/skybox is outputting a ntsc signal.. my guess is that you would need a converter to send an ntsc feed to the slingbox..

Have just set up slingbox with Sky+. Initially had picture only in black and white when using an S Video cable. Have since swapped to use the scart output (+ scart to composite video adaptor) to composite video (yellow plug. This works perfectly well producing a good colour picture. No problems with sound from composite audio plugs - above S-video output on Sky box. Also, no need for a PAL to NTSC converter.
